首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

正则表达式sql oracle确保以标准格式输入数据库中的订单号。

正则表达式是一种用于匹配和处理文本的强大工具,可以用来验证和规范输入的数据格式。SQL是一种用于管理和操作关系型数据库的标准语言,而Oracle是一种常用的关系型数据库管理系统。

为了确保以标准格式输入数据库中的订单号,可以使用正则表达式来验证输入的订单号是否符合指定的格式要求。以下是一个示例的正则表达式,用于匹配标准的订单号格式:

^[A-Za-z0-9]{8}-[A-Za-z0-9]{4}-[A-Za-z0-9]{4}-[A-Za-z0-9]{4}-[A-Za-z0-9]{12}$

该正则表达式的含义是:以字母和数字组成的8个字符,后跟一个连字符,再后跟4个字符,再后跟一个连字符,再后跟4个字符,再后跟一个连字符,最后跟12个字符。

使用该正则表达式可以在前端开发中进行输入验证,确保用户输入的订单号符合标准格式。在后端开发中,可以在接收到订单号后,使用正则表达式进行验证,以确保数据的准确性和一致性。

对于Oracle数据库,可以使用正则表达式函数进行查询和处理。例如,可以使用REGEXP_LIKE函数来判断一个订单号是否符合指定的格式。示例代码如下:

SELECT order_number FROM orders WHERE REGEXP_LIKE(order_number, '^[A-Za-z0-9]{8}-[A-Za-z0-9]{4}-[A-Za-z0-9]{4}-[A-Za-z0-9]{4}-[A-Za-z0-9]{12}$');

在云计算领域,腾讯云提供了多种与数据库相关的产品和服务,例如云数据库MySQL、云数据库SQL Server、云数据库MongoDB等。这些产品可以帮助用户轻松管理和运维数据库,提供高可用性和可扩展性。

腾讯云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b_mysql

腾讯云数据库SQL Server产品介绍链接地址:https://cloud.tencent.com/product/cdb_sqlserver

腾讯云数据库MongoDB产品介绍链接地址:https://cloud.tencent.com/product/cdb_mongodb

通过使用腾讯云的数据库产品,用户可以快速搭建和管理数据库环境,并且可以根据业务需求进行灵活的扩展和调整。同时,腾讯云还提供了丰富的安全措施和监控功能,保障数据的安全性和稳定性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券